The largest DuraStar wall-mounted unit, for spaces smaller models cannot cover

Some rooms defy the usual calculations: a living room with a cathedral ceiling, a mezzanine open to the main floor, a finished basement spanning the entire footprint, or a large living area added to the back of a house. The DURASTAR Sirius Heat Wall-Mounted Heat Pump | 33,000 BTU - R454B is the largest format in the DuraStar wall-mounted lineup. It was designed for these spaces, with a maximum airflow of 830 CFM and certified heating capacity down to -30 °C.

Its certified ratings are 20.0 SEER2, 11.7 EER2, and 10.5 HSPF2. The system is ENERGY STAR certified with the cold-climate designation and appears on Hydro-Québec's list with a $3,720 LogisVert rebate, the highest amount among the DuraStar wall-mounted heat pumps we offer.

Certified capacities matching its size

  • At 8 °C: 36,000 BTU/h, range of 19,900 to 38,200 BTU/h, COP of 3.22
  • At -8 °C: 31,000 BTU/h, COP of 2.61
  • At -15 °C: 34,600 BTU/h, COP of 1.91
  • At -30 °C: up to 17,800 BTU/h, COP of 1.36
  • Cooling: 33,000 BTU/h, range of 15,000 to 35,900 BTU/h

These figures come from certificate AHRI 215359269, published by NEEP. Even in the coldest winter weather, the unit still delivers nearly the nominal capacity of an 18,000 BTU heat pump. This makes it suitable as the primary heating source in a very large room, with baseboard heaters or the existing heating system providing supplemental heat during cold snaps.

One unit or two smaller ones: the real question

A 33,000 BTU unit blows all its air from a single point. In an open, unobstructed space, that is a strength: one unit, one condenser, one line set, and one circuit. In a home divided into enclosed rooms, heat will not travel around corners, regardless of capacity. During the assessment, we therefore compare this format honestly with two smaller units or a multi-zone solution. We recommend the 33,000 BTU model when the room is genuinely open, the heat load justifies it, and the selected wall allows the airflow to travel across the longest dimension of the space.

Our starting point for sizing is approximately 18,000 BTU/h per 1,000 square feet. We then adjust it according to the actual volume: a 16-foot ceiling contains twice as much air as an 8-foot ceiling, and heat accumulates overhead. Ceiling fans, when present, help bring that air back down in winter.

Four airflow levels for a large space

The indoor fan offers 447, 530, 677, and 830 CFM. Sound levels range from 23 dB(A) in Silence mode to 56 dB(A) in Turbo mode. In a large room, the lowest setting suits quiet evenings, while the maximum setting helps circulate the air after a long absence. The vertical louver oscillates automatically; the horizontal direction is adjusted manually during commissioning according to the shape of the room.

The $3,720 LogisVert rebate

The system carries ENERGY STAR ID 3621164 and qualifies for a $3,720 rebate for owners of existing homes, according to the LogisVert list in effect on the installation date. An enhanced rebate applies to certain multi-unit buildings. We confirm your eligibility before signing and prepare the supporting documents for your application.

A 43-pound wall unit and a 157-pound condenser: preparing for installation

The larger the unit, the more preparation matters. Here are the elements we check before submitting a quote.

The indoor unit wall

The wall-mounted unit measures 49.57 x 11.14 x 14.25 inches and weighs 43.2 pounds. Its mounting plate must be secured to the framing, and the wall must provide enough clear width and sufficient clearance below the ceiling for air intake. A unit of this size produces a significant amount of condensate in summer: we plan its drainage from the outset, by gravity whenever possible, or with a condensate pump clearly identified in the quote.

The outdoor unit

The condenser measures 37.24 x 16.14 x 31.89 inches and weighs 157.0 pounds. At this weight, we prefer a ground support or stable base above the snow line. Its sound level of 64 dB(A) means it should be placed away from bedroom windows and neighbouring patios, a basic rule in areas where properties are close together, in Laval as in Longueuil. The base pan heater and anti-corrosion coating are included as standard equipment.

Refrigerant lines

This system uses 3/8- and 3/4-inch lines. They are precharged for 25 feet and can reach 164 feet, with a maximum elevation difference of 82 feet. Beyond the precharged length, 0.32 ounces of refrigerant must be added per foot. The 3/4-inch diameter is uncommon in existing residential installations; in most cases, we install new lines. The installation remains fully exposed, with no work inside the walls, and a finished line cover can be added.

The electrical circuit

208-230 V power supply, 34 A MCA, and a 35 A circuit breaker. These are among the most demanding electrical requirements in the wall-mounted lineup. We check the capacity of the electrical service and the available space in the panel, especially in homes already heated with electricity. If an upgrade is required, we tell you before signing.

Unit features

The wireless remote offers Follow Me, which measures the temperature where you are, ECO/GEAR to reduce cooling consumption, Sleep, Silence, Turbo, Active Clean, and Gentle. Freeze protection maintains the room at 8 °C during an extended absence. Since R-454B is an A2L refrigerant, the unit includes a factory-installed leak detector. Wi-Fi is not built in; DuraStar offers a separately sold Wi-Fi adapter module, and the unit is compatible with the DRSTAT101 wall thermostat.

Normal operating behaviour

In winter, the unit periodically defrosts its outdoor coil for five to ten minutes; white vapour may then escape outdoors and heat delivery stops temporarily. After shutdown, the compressor waits three minutes before restarting. A slight hissing sound and plastic cracking noises are also normal. A burning smell, a tripped circuit breaker, or water dripping indoors requires shutting off the unit and arranging a service visit.

Maintenance

  • Clean the indoor filters every two weeks during the season: on an 830 CFM unit, dirty filters quickly become noticeable.
  • Clear snow and leaves from the condenser.
